@ -0,0 +1,110 @@
|
||||
import * as plugins from '../../plugins.js';
|
||||
import type { AcmeOptions, CertificateData } from '../models/certificate-types.js';
|
||||
import { CertificateEvents } from '../events/certificate-events.js';
|
||||
|
||||
/**
|
||||
* Manages ACME challenges and certificate validation
|
||||
*/
|
||||
export class AcmeChallengeHandler extends plugins.EventEmitter {
|
||||
private options: AcmeOptions;
|
||||
private client: any; // ACME client from plugins
|
||||
private pendingChallenges: Map<string, any>;
|
||||
|
||||
/**
|
||||
* Creates a new ACME challenge handler
|
||||
* @param options ACME configuration options
|
||||
*/
|
||||
constructor(options: AcmeOptions) {
|
||||
super();
|
||||
this.options = options;
|
||||
this.pendingChallenges = new Map();
|
||||
|
||||
// Initialize ACME client if needed
|
||||
// This is just a placeholder implementation since we don't use the actual
|
||||
// client directly in this implementation - it's handled by Port80Handler
|
||||
this.client = null;
|
||||
console.log('Created challenge handler with options:',
|
||||
options.accountEmail,
|
||||
options.useProduction ? 'production' : 'staging'
|
||||
);
|
||||
}
|
||||
|
||||
/**
|
||||
* Gets or creates the ACME account key
|
||||
*/
|
||||
private getAccountKey(): Buffer {
|
||||
// Implementation details would depend on plugin requirements
|
||||
// This is a simplified version
|
||||
if (!this.options.certificateStore) {
|
||||
throw new Error('Certificate store is required for ACME challenges');
|
||||
}
|
||||
|
||||
// This is just a placeholder - actual implementation would check for
|
||||
// existing account key and create one if needed
|
||||
return Buffer.from('account-key-placeholder');
|
||||
}
|
||||
|
||||
/**
|
||||
* Validates a domain using HTTP-01 challenge
|
||||
* @param domain Domain to validate
|
||||
* @param challengeToken ACME challenge token
|
||||
* @param keyAuthorization Key authorization for the challenge
|
||||
*/
|
||||
public async handleHttpChallenge(
|
||||
domain: string,
|
||||
challengeToken: string,
|
||||
keyAuthorization: string
|
||||
): Promise<void> {
|
||||
// Store challenge for response
|
||||
this.pendingChallenges.set(challengeToken, keyAuthorization);
|
||||
|
||||
try {
|
||||
// Wait for challenge validation - this would normally be handled by the ACME client
|
||||
await new Promise(resolve => setTimeout(resolve, 1000));
|
||||
this.emit(CertificateEvents.CERTIFICATE_ISSUED, {
|
||||
domain,
|
||||
success: true
|
||||
});
|
||||
} catch (error) {
|
||||
this.emit(CertificateEvents.CERTIFICATE_FAILED, {
|
||||
domain,
|
||||
error: error instanceof Error ? error.message : String(error),
|
||||
isRenewal: false
|
||||
});
|
||||
throw error;
|
||||
} finally {
|
||||
// Clean up the challenge
|
||||
this.pendingChallenges.delete(challengeToken);
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Responds to an HTTP-01 challenge request
|
||||
* @param token Challenge token from the request path
|
||||
* @returns The key authorization if found
|
||||
*/
|
||||
public getChallengeResponse(token: string): string | null {
|
||||
return this.pendingChallenges.get(token) || null;
|
||||
}
|
||||
|
||||
/**
|
||||
* Checks if a request path is an ACME challenge
|
||||
* @param path Request path
|
||||
* @returns True if this is an ACME challenge request
|
||||
*/
|
||||
public isAcmeChallenge(path: string): boolean {
|
||||
return path.startsWith('/.well-known/acme-challenge/');
|
||||
}
|
||||
|
||||
/**
|
||||
* Extracts the challenge token from an ACME challenge path
|
||||
* @param path Request path
|
||||
* @returns The challenge token if valid
|
||||
*/
|
||||
public extractChallengeToken(path: string): string | null {
|
||||
if (!this.isAcmeChallenge(path)) return null;
|
||||
|
||||
const parts = path.split('/');
|
||||
return parts[parts.length - 1] || null;
|
||||
}
|
||||
}
